In Eclipse 3.5.x, click Help > Install New Software

You use Eclipse's standard installation process to download and install GroovyEclipse. The Eclipse user interface for software installation and update varies between 3.4 and 3.5. 

Eclipse 3.4.2 users: click Help > Software Updates and follow the dialogs to work with or add the GroovyEclipse update site - see step 3 for the URL.

 

To add the GroovyEclipse plugin download site to your Available Software Sites, click Add on the Available Software page. 

If you have previously added the site, click the blue down arrow and select if from the drop-down list of your available sites.

 

On the Add Site page, type a name in the Name box to assign a name of your preference to the site, or leave it blank to use a default site name constructed from repository metadata. 

In the Location box type the download URL the URL that corresponds to your version of Eclipse, and click Next

If you use 3.4.2 - "http://ci.repository.codehaus.org/greclipse/snapshot/e34" or 

If you use 3.5.x - "http://dist.springsource.org/milestone/GRECLIPSE/e3.5/"

 

On the Available Software page, checkmark Groovy-Eclipse Plugin, and if you wish to work with the plugin sources, Groovy Eclipse SDK

Click Next

Don't checkmark Groovy Compilers - they are included in the GroovyEclipse Plugin.

 

You can review the components to be installed on the Install Detailspage. 

As noted above, the GroovyEclipse Plugin includes two versions of the Groovy compilers: v1.7-beta2 (enabled) and v1.6.5. 

The JDT Core patch is an update to the Eclipse Java Development Tool (JDT) that enables Groovy/JDT integration.

 

Accept the license agreement and click Finish.

Eclipse prompts you to restart.

After Eclipse restarts, you can see that Eclipse's File > New menu now includes wizards for creating Groovy projects, classes, and test cases. 

You have successfully installed GroovyEclipse.
